What this job can offer you

This is an exciting time to join Remote and make a personal difference in the global employment space as a Senior Product Designer - Pay Ecosystem. Senior Designers at Remote are highly experienced and are masters of their end-to-end design craft. They autonomously own design for a dev team or feature area while supported by their larger team.

The payroll team helps build experiences that empower our customers to pay anyone, anywhere safely and compliantly. This is one of our most strategically important and high profile teams at Remote. Here you will be challenged as a designer in the best way - this role is filled with fascinating, complex and meaty challenges that require primary research, robust strategy, innovative concepts and simple but brilliant execution.

You'll be working with a thriving cross-discipline team of designers, developers, and PMs, and with a talented, close-knit team of product designers who will inspire you and support your growth. The design team is a thriving and growing community of designers who are maturing Remote’s end-to-end design practice.

Remote Compensation Philosophy

Remote's Total Rewards philosophy is to ensure fair, unbiased compensation and fair equity pay along with competitive benefits in all locations in which we operate. We do not agree to or encourage cheap-labor practices and therefore we ensure to pay above in-location rates. We hope to inspire other companies to support global talent-hiring and bring local wealth to developing countries.

At first glance our salary bands seem quite wide - here is some context. At Remote we have international operations and a globally distributed workforce. We use geo ranges to consider geographic pay differentials as part of our global compensation strategy to remain competitive in various markets while we hiring globally.

The base salary range for this full-time position is USD 57,350 to USD 129,050. Our salary ranges are determined by role, level and location, and our job titles may span more than one career level. The actual base pay for the successful candidate in this role is dependent upon many factors such as location, transferable or job-related skills, work experience, relevant training, business needs, and market demands. The base salary range may be subject to change.

At Remote, we foster internal mobility as a key element of our culture of employee growth and development, supported by a compensation philosophy that guarantees pay equity and fairness. Therefore, all compensation changes associated with an internal move will be reviewed by the Total Rewards & People Enablement team on a case by case basis.
